Episode description

In the latest episode of Pod Bless Canada, MLI Munk Senior Fellow Shuvaloy Majumdar was rejoined by Balkan Devlen, a frequent MLI author and an Associate Professor in the Department of Political Science at the University of Copenhagen. Devlen is a foremost expert when it comes to the security policies of Turkey and Russia. Following up on their discussion from earlier this year, the two discuss Turkey’s recent invasion of Kurdish held territories in Northern Syria and what the situation means for Ankara’s position vis-à-vis NATO and Russia. Majumdar and Devlen explore the complex geopolitical fallout that has emanated from President Trump’s abandonment of the West’s Kurdish allies, and what Canada’s interests are in the region.
